> To overcome sasl x openldap I removed php_ldap and at least it trys to build
> apache, but I got the following Warning:
>
> !!*** APXS was not found, so mod_suphp will not be built! ***!!
>
> at the end apache was build and a rpm -qip apache-...rpm includes:
>   apache::with_suphp = yes
>
> Does I miss some prerequisit again ?
> Is mod_suphp build eaven with the above  messages ?

No, you can safely ignore this message. In our Apache package we
explicitly build mod_suphp.c statically from within the Apache source
tree. APXS would be only required if a DSO mod_suphp.so would be used,
but this is not in OpenPKG because we statically built mod_suphp into
the "apache" executable. So, everything is ok. Just ignore the message.
